Pakistan thrashed the United Arab Emirates (UAE) by 31 runs in the T20I Tri-Nation Series match at Sharjah Cricket Stadium on Thursday evening.
Chasing a decent 172-run target for victory, the hosts managed to reach 140/7 in the allocated 20 overs.
Alishan Sharafu was the top scorer for the UAE with 68 runs, followed by skipper Mohammad Waseem, who scored 19 runs. Dhruv Parashar contributed an unbeaten 18 runs, and Haider Ali 12. No other batter could enter the double figures.
Abrar Ahmed secured the T20I career-best figure of 4/9 in his quota of four overs with 15 dot balls. Shaheen Shah Afridi and Mohammad Nawaz got one wicket each. Haider Ali was run out. Player of the match: Abrar Ahmed.

Winning the toss and electing to bat first, Pakistan reached 171/5 in the allocated 20 overs. Fakhar Zaman (77 not out) and Mohammad Nawaz (37 not out) put Pakistan back on track after losing five wickets with just 80 runs on the board.
The set batters plundered 74 runs in the last five overs during a 91-run partnership to enable the Green shirts to set a decent 172-run target for the hosts.
Sahibzada Farhan contributed 16 runs, Mohammad Haris 14 and Saim Ayub 11 runs. Haider Ali bagged two wickets while Junaid Siddique, Muhammad Rohid and Dhruv Prashar took one wicket each.
Pakistan lead the points table with six points. Afghanistan have secured four points. The hosts are looking for their first win in the tournament.
Pakistan and Afghanistan will contest for the final match trophy. Afghanistan beat Pakistan in the second match, while Salman Aga-XI secured victory in the first match.
